Really nice, quiet spot between a golf course and the water. Toilet block and beach to make fire or a bbq. Several bays along the road and other vans, but very peaceful
Report Check-Instayed a bit before this location on a very green patch plenty of space for many tents. right by the beach. Very windy had to anchor the tent to the car. The beach in this area is not so nice though, it's got a lot of clay.
Report Check-InGreat spot, right on the beach and very quiet at night even though you are next to the road. Lots of dog walkers and golfers. We stayed in the bays before the carpark as we would fit in the barrier, see picture.
Report Check-InBeautiful spot and you get a lovely sunset if you park in the right spot! toilets seem to be still open and it's 2130. I saw another post which said they open at 8am, my thoughts so far are perhaps they don't shut them anymore! lovely and quiet, touch windy but beautiful.
Report Check-In3 bays alongside a quiet road and a car park with a hight restriction 7’6. Quiet place but maybe windy.
Report Check-InWe stayed overnight a little further up the road in the car park. 54.97431, -3.34540. There is a height restriction in place, 7' 6" and no caravans permitted. Strong Westerly wind, so not a suitable overnight spot for a roof tent in January! Update May 21, there are 'clean' public toilets open from 8am.
